Output 8b660198b4e187aced82364c032329f0d19519087d9329be593b17eece375a31:0

value
3716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d34ab76dfff0900b234875ff23ae58eaae8b413e OP_EQUAL
address
3LxE1R28o5q3V7bEb2TrzwsDS4xsD2B4tM
transaction
8b660198b4e187aced82364c032329f0d19519087d9329be593b17eece375a31
spent
true